WebA simple solution to check for a NaN in Python is using the mathematical function math.isnan (). It returns True if the specified parameter is a NaN and False otherwise. 1 2 3 4 5 6 7 8 9 import math if __name__ == '__main__': x = float('nan') isNaN = math.isnan(x) print(isNaN) # True Download Run Code 2. Using numpy.isnan () function WebOct 19, 2024 · 8. I've been using the following and type casting it to a string and checking for the nan value. (str (df.at [index, 'column']) == 'nan') This allows me to check specific value …
python - 熊貓單元測試:如何斷言NaT和NaN值相等? - 堆棧內存溢出
WebJun 3, 2009 · Here are three ways where you can test a variable is "NaN" or not. import pandas as pd import numpy as np import math # For single variable all three libraries … WebDetect missing values. Return a boolean same-sized object indicating if the values are NA. NA values, such as None or numpy.NaN, gets mapped to True values. Everything else gets mapped to False values. Characters such as empty strings '' or numpy.inf are not considered NA values (unless you set pandas.options.mode.use_inf_as_na = True ). Returns subhaulers trucking
Python NumPy Nan - Complete Tutorial - Python Guides
WebJun 15, 2024 · Check if the Numpy array is Nan in Python To check for Nan values in a Numpy array we can use the function Np.isNan (). The output array is true for the indices that are Nan in the original array and false for the rest. Let’s take an example to check the Nan values in the given array Web在NumPy和Pandas中, nan nan和NaT NaT 。 因此,當在單元測試期間比較結果時,如何斷言返回的值是那些值之一 即使我使用pandas.util.testing ,一個簡單的assertEqual自然也會失敗。 WebFeb 1, 2024 · Method #2: Using not + all () This checks for the truthness of all elements of the tuple using all () and with not, returns True if there is no None element. Python3 test_tup = (10, 4, 5, 6, None) print("The original tuple : " + str(test_tup)) res = not all(test_tup) print("Does tuple contain any None value ? : " + str(res)) Output : pain in right thigh and leg